Output 86d508064b832a2485efa32208e418bbce2deefd0ac7a12bbc39885ad747602a:39
- value
- 149714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b62fcc67af043f16e912a4f8141e13366c29ec0e OP_EQUAL
- address
- 3JJLAYxtB7NdaT25MWomJueY9QP8u7xdNj
- transaction
- 86d508064b832a2485efa32208e418bbce2deefd0ac7a12bbc39885ad747602a
- confirmations
- 146560
- spent
- true